Job description

Summary
About the Position: Located at 412TH MDG Edwards Air Force Base, Edwards AFB, CA 93524.The Defense Health Agency (DHA) is participating in an alternate personnel system known as the Acquisition Demonstration Project (AcqDemo).
This is a Direct Hire Solicitation
This job is open to
  • The public
    U.S. Citizens, Nationals or those who owe allegiance to the U.S.

Duties
  • Perform administrative work in support of the 412th Medical Group Uniform Business Office (UBO) encompassing Third Party Collections, Medical Affirmative Claims, and Medical Services Account programs.
  • Provide consultation to group, wing, and command level working groups and committees, as well as, to flight, Squadron, and Group Commanders.
  • Interpret guidelines, adapt procedures, decide, approach and resolve specific problems for assignments that affect the overall operations of the Uniform Business Office.
  • Audit and maintain Medical Service Account {MSA) general accounts.
  • Reconcile the cash funds and account receivables daily and monthly, examines supporting documents, ensures accounting data are accurate and In balance and confirms appropriate information Is documented in the automated system.
  • Analyze and examine accounting data for proper maintenance of accounts. Ensure funds are managed within allowable constraints and to ensure there are no violations of laws.
  • Perform duties relating to the Medical Affirmative Claims (MAC) program.
  • Serve as facility point of contact for all actions associated with Third Party Collection (TPC) Program contract.
  • Provide a technical interface between the Program Office and other organizations involved in the contract process.
  • Prepare standard operating procedures to support revisions.

Requirements
Conditions of Employment
  • Appointment to this position is subject to a background investigation to determine your suitability for Federal employment.
  • Must obtain and maintain Financial Management Certification Level 1.
  • This position has a mandatory seasonal influenza vaccination requirement and is therefore subject to annual seasonal influenza vaccinations.
  • Must be able to obtain and maintain current Basic Life Support (BLS) certification through the American Red Cross or American Heart Association. Advanced certification (e.g., ALS) does not supersede BLS.
  • Initial and periodic tests/immunizations required for all employees include Tuberculin Skin Test (TST/PPD), Varicella (chicken pox), measles, mumps, rubella (MMR), Hepatitis B, Seasonal Influenza, tetanus, diphtheria and pertussis (Tdap).
  • A Personnel Security Investigation is required.
